Chaudrehr Population - Kangra, Himachal Pradesh
Chaudrehr is a medium size village located in Palampur Tehsil of Kangra district, Himachal Pradesh with total 130 families residing. The Chaudrehr village has population of 500 of which 255 are males while 245 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chaudrehr village population of children with age 0-6 is 50 which makes up 10.00 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chaudrehr village is 961 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Chaudrehr as per census is 923, higher than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.
Chaudrehr village has lower liter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chaudrehr village was 81.33 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Chaudrehr Male literacy stands at 89.52 % while female literacy rate was 72.85 %.

Chaudrehr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 130 | - | - |
Population | 500 | 255 | 245 |
Child (0-6) | 50 | 26 | 24 |
Schedule Caste | 281 | 144 | 137 |
Schedule Tribe | 47 | 23 | 24 |
Literacy | 81.33 % | 89.52 % | 72.85 % |
Total Workers | 150 | 109 | 41 |
Main Worker | 102 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 48 | 25 | 23 |
